Understanding Vietnam's Renewable Energy Push: Policies and Opportunities for Solar Lighting

Vietnam's National Power Development Plan VIII (PDP8), approved in May 2023, is a cornerstone of its energy strategy, aiming for renewable energy to constitute 30.9-39.2% of total power by 2030 and 67.5-71.5% by 2050. This includes a specific target of 6.8 GW for rooftop solar by 2030, signaling strong governmental support for solar deployment. While direct Feed-in-Tariffs (FiTs) might primarily target large-scale grid-tied projects, the overarching policy environment encourages investment in green technologies, including standalone solar lighting for public spaces, infrastructure, and remote communities. Procurement initiatives aligning with these national goals may find support through various local incentives or tax considerations for sustainable projects.

Beyond Savings: The Environmental and Economic Imperatives of Solar Lighting in Vietnam

Implementing solar lighting in Vietnam delivers multi-faceted benefits. Environmentally, it significantly reduces carbon emissions, aligning with Vietnam’s climate change commitments and decreasing reliance on fossil fuels. Economically, beyond eliminating electricity bills, solar lighting lowers the Total Cost of Ownership (TCO) by negating trenching, cabling, and grid connection costs, especially in remote or difficult-to-access areas. It provides reliable illumination where grid power is unstable or unavailable, enhancing public safety, extending operational hours for businesses, and improving the quality of life in underserved communities.

Engineering for Resilience: Technical Specifications for Solar Lighting in Vietnam's Climate

Vietnam's tropical monsoon climate, characterized by high temperatures (average 23-29°C), high humidity, heavy rainfall, and occasional typhoons, demands robust solar lighting systems. Key technical considerations for procurement include:

  • IP Rating: Minimum IP65, with IP66 preferred for superior dust and water ingress protection, crucial for components exposed to monsoons and humidity.
  • Battery Technology: Lithium Iron Phosphate (LiFePO4) batteries are highly recommended due to their longer cycle life (2000-6000 cycles), superior thermal stability at high temperatures, and better safety profile compared to Li-ion alternatives.
  • Solar Panels: High-efficiency monocrystalline solar panels are ideal for maximizing energy capture within limited space, especially during periods of lower sunlight intensity or overcast weather.
  • Charge Controllers: Maximum Power Point Tracking (MPPT) controllers are essential for optimizing power extraction from solar panels, particularly under varying irradiance conditions. Integrated intelligent dimming and timing functions further enhance energy efficiency.
  • Material Durability: Robust aluminum alloy housing and corrosion-resistant coatings are necessary to withstand humidity and salt spray in coastal areas.

The Investment Equation: Cost Analysis and ROI for Solar Lighting Projects in Vietnam

While the initial capital outlay for a quality solar lighting system might be higher than traditional grid-connected lighting, a comprehensive TCO analysis reveals significant long-term savings. Global solar panel costs have seen a substantial reduction in recent years, making solar lighting increasingly competitive. Factors influencing project cost include LED wattage, battery capacity, solar panel size, pole height, and smart features (e.g., motion sensors, IoT connectivity). Procurement professionals should evaluate suppliers based on component quality, warranty periods, and projected lifespan to ensure a strong Return on Investment (ROI) through eliminated electricity bills and reduced maintenance over decades.

Anticipating Roadblocks: Common Challenges and Mitigation Strategies in Vietnam's Solar Lighting Deployment

Deploying solar lighting in Vietnam can present challenges such as initial capital investment, ensuring consistent product quality, logistics for remote installations, and the need for skilled local technicians for maintenance. To mitigate these:

  • Capital: Explore phased implementation or public-private partnerships.
  • Quality: Partner with reputable suppliers providing international certifications and extensive warranties.
  • Logistics/Maintenance: Prioritize suppliers with local support networks or establish training programs for local personnel.
  • Theft: Design solutions with tamper-proof components and secure mounting mechanisms.

Strategic Sourcing: Key Criteria for Selecting a Solar Lighting Supplier in Vietnam

Selecting the right supplier is critical for project success. Procurement should prioritize:

  • Certifications: Verify international standards like ISO 9001 (Quality Management), CE, RoHS, and IEC for components.
  • Warranty: Look for comprehensive warranties – typically 20-25 years for solar panels, 5-10 years for batteries, and 3-5 years for LED fixtures and controllers.
  • Track Record & References: Evaluate previous projects, especially those in similar climatic conditions or geographical regions.
  • Customization Capability: The ability to design systems tailored to specific lumen requirements, operational hours, and local weather patterns.
  • After-Sales Support: Availability of spare parts, technical assistance, and potential for local servicing or training.

Ensuring Longevity: Best Practices for Installation and Maintenance of Solar Lighting in Vietnam

Proper installation and routine maintenance are vital for maximizing the lifespan and performance of solar lighting systems. Best practices include thorough site assessment to determine optimal solar panel orientation and tilt angles, secure mounting to withstand strong winds and typhoons, and proper cabling to prevent water ingress. Regular maintenance should involve cleaning solar panels to remove dust and debris, checking battery health, inspecting electrical connections, and addressing any signs of wear or damage. Training local staff on these procedures ensures long-term operational efficiency and sustainability.

Batteries and the environment
How do used batteries pollute the environment?
The components of these batteries are sealed inside the battery case during use and will not affect the environment. However, after long-term mechanical wear and corrosion, the heavy metals and acids and alkalis inside will leak out and enter the soil or water sources, and then enter the human food chain through various ways. The whole process is briefly described as follows: soil or water source - microorganisms - animals - circulating dust - crops - food - human body - nerves - deposition and complications. Heavy metals absorbed from the environment by other water-source, plant-food digestion organisms can pass through the biomagnification of the food chain and accumulate in thousands of higher-level organisms step by step. Then they enter the human body through food and accumulate in certain organs. Cause chronic poisoning.

What is a solar cell? What are the advantages of solar cells?
A solar cell is a device that converts light energy (mainly sunlight) into electrical energy. The principle is the photovoltaic effect, that is, based on the built-in electric field of the PN junction, the photogenerated carriers are separated and reach both sides of the junction to generate a photovoltage, which is connected to an external circuit to obtain power output. The power of solar cells is related to the intensity of light. The stronger the light, the stronger the power output.
